    Senior A&R Manager

    This role will report to the Director of A&R and will be responsible for the strategic management and operational exploitation of Sony Music Entertainment’ South Africa’s (SMESA) roster of artists. The role will be responsible for identifying, evaluating talent and serving as a liaison between assigned artists and the label while representing the commercial interest of both .

    What you'll do:

    • Identify and source potential artists, labels, catalogues and repertoire for SMESA roster to deliver the artistic goals of the company
    • Manage the full roster of SMESA providing strategic and operational directives by ensuring the roster reflects the opportunity in the marketplace and that a healthy churn rate is achieved to avoid artist stagnancy and low release frequency.
    • Work with SMESA artists and their managers as well as other members of the creative community, including but not limited to producers, writers, engineers, studios etc. to deliver a steady state of availability of new release repertoire of the highest quality from the SMESA roster
    • Oversee the delivery of all recorded music assets including but not limited to audio and video masters, artwork, lyrics and accompanying legal and label documentation required by Product teams to deliver for digital ingestion
    • Liaise with the Marketing Director and the Marketing team to develop effective and creative marketing plans for each artist on the SMESA roster considering all and any revenue streams available for exploitation and assisting with maximizing such exploitation including but not limited to the procurement of synchronization deals with third parties
    • Collaborate with Marketing Teams to develop and procure synchronization licenses with third parties to drive Licensing revenue for the company
    • Work with the L&BA Director SMEA to oversee and implement acquisitions for the SMESA roster to ensure compliance with best practice and company policy
    • Work with A&R Director SMEA to identify and develop artists and repertoire for international exploitation
    • Adopt best practice approach to innovation in the business whether it be digital formats, content creation or scheduling of product, always driven by artist consideration, consumer needs and audience insight
    • Provide leadership and mentorship to A&R team at SMESA to ensure skills development and a robust succession plan are in place
    • Manage relationships with SMESA artists and their representatives
    • Attend regular meetings with the A&R Director and L&BA Director to review the roster with other relevant Internal stakeholders

    Who you are:

    • Must have relevant tertiary Diploma or Certificate in Business Management, Marketing or Communications
    • Qualification in Sound Engineering or similar studio recording related field will be an added advantage
    • Solid A&R experience gained within the music industry
    • Understanding of market forces and how-to best position artists towards relevant markets
    • Proven experience of delivering creative and cost-effective music content for streaming exploitation
    • Understanding of P&L management and business planning process
    • Demonstrated complex problem solving and decision making and the organisational skills to manage and prioritise varied workload
    • Demonstrated ability to quickly build credible working relationships at all levels of the company
    • Experience successfully driving collaborative working and managing conflicting points of view
    • Persuasive and confident communicator who has a strong network of key contacts and an excellent negotiator
    • Enthusiastic and engaging with clear passion for artists and repertoire
    • Provides clear direction in a collaborative and mentoring way to drive a dynamic and changing environment and achieve results
    • Entrepreneurial approach to take initiative and capitalise on opportunity whilst remaining calm under pressure
    • Confident, credible and self-aware individual
